1. Diclofenac may improve muscle function by reducing pain and inflammation, allowing better mobility and strength in musculoskeletal conditions.
2. While diclofenac alleviates pain in musculoskeletal disorders, its long-term use might inhibit muscle repair, potentially impacting strength.
